android集成百度OCR实现身份证、银行卡、营业执照等识别
声明:申请步骤账号这一块比较懒,直接借用了[大千世界小书童] 大神的原图,有想看大神的可以直接去看,地址:www.jianshu.com/p/a9b5d8b22…
第一步:先登录百度智能云
image
登录进入,没有百度账号的需要注册一下,进入界面找到如下图文字识别
image
进入文字识别主界面,可以看到一些你集成百度OCR识别功能的调用详细数据的,如下图
image
然后点击创建应用(借用下百度文档图片)
image
这里因为保证Ak的安全所以百度希望通过授权的方式初始化Ak,因为放到项目里面很容易被别人破解
image
下载如上图的文件,然后放到我们需要集成的应用里面的main下面新建一个assets文件里面
image
做完这些还有 一个最重要的前期准备,那就是去下载SDK(ai.baidu.com/sdk/#ocr)
下载完成后,得到压缩包,解压如下图
image
做完这些后就可以开始集成了
1.(必须)将下载包libs目录中的ocr-sdk.jar文件拷贝到工程libs目录中,并加入工程依赖。
2.(必须)将libs目录下armeabi,arm64-v8a,armeabi-v7a,x86文件夹按需添加到android studio工程src/main/jniLibs目录中。这里如果不想手动创建jniLibs这这个文件夹,只需要在gradle文件里面的Android下加上如下图这句话
sourceSets {main {jniLibs.srcDirs = ['libs']}}复制代码
3.可选)如果需要使用UI模块,请在Android studio中以模块方式导入下载包中的ocr-ui文件夹。这个看个人意愿,如果需求可以自己去实现,这里就介绍导入的,很简单只需要
image
然后一路next即可。
下面是我的demo截图:
1.jpg
2.jpg
3.jpg
4.jpg
github地址: https://github.com/NamePretty/BaiDuOcr
android集成百度OCR实现身份证、银行卡、营业执照等识别相关推荐
- Android集成百度OCR图片文字识别——总结
近期由于工作内容的需要,我要给项目集成一个图片文字识别功能,据说百度的不错,所以今天写一个关于百度OCR的集成总结,以便以后再次使用不用去看官方文档. 首先肯定是要在百度管理平台注册账号并登录,然后照 ...
- android百度导航实现,Android 集成百度地图实现设备定位
Android 集成百度地图实现设备定位 步骤1: 申请android 端SDK : http://lbsyun.baidu.com/ 步骤2: 下载基础版SDK 步骤3: 下载示例程序 步骤4: 开 ...
- Android 集成百度地图之申请TTS授权最新版
Android 集成百度地图之申请TTS授权最新版. 前提:登录百度地图开放平台,且已创建好应用. 开发文档-Android 导航SDK-TTS授权申请. 这里有个坑,简单说下,进入http://yu ...
- Android集成百度语音识别到HelloWorld需要注意什么?(保姆级教学)
Android集成百度语音识别怎么避坑? 首先先放一张集成失败的图(记得一定要用真机,因为它不支持VAD,我这里使用Pixel2): 首先你去百度搜索"百度语音识别",或者点击我下 ...
- Android集成百度定位以及导航详解
Android集成百度定位以及导航详解 百度地图Android SDK 官方下载地址: 包括类参考.示例代码 ...
- Android集成百度定位,超详细,拒绝坑,附demo!!!
众所周知,百度地图作为定位,地图,导航界的大佬之一,我们的项目中有这方面的需求,百度地图集成也是个不错的选择. 百度地图集成成本极低,首先,它免费,官网文档清晰,demo明确,但还是有很多人要才坑,正 ...
- Xamarin.Android接入百度OCR,进行身份证扫描识别
请大家多多关注和订阅我的专栏,我会不定时发布关于xamarin的文章!多谢! 1 效果图 2.准备 1.注册百度智能云账号 2.创建文字识别应用 3.创建AAR库 4.集成系统 2.1 注册百度智能云 ...
- Android集成百度语音识别
实现这个功能的目的,是我看见我公司硬件工程师给客户回答问题的时候用公司研发的APP,每次都是手动输入打字,看着他带着老花镜的样子,于心不忍,毕竟咱就是干这个的. 实现效果 集成 百度语音实时识别 ht ...
- Android 集成百度地图AR识别SDK(二)
废话 今天我们开始集成百度地图AR识别SDK(后面简称AR SDK)的第二章,这一章我们主要讲Android Studio如何配置AR SDK 我们如果单单只看文档的话,很难看懂如何集成,我们需要结合 ...
最新文章
- 计算机网络谢希仁第七版课后答案第二章 物理层
- 详解keepalived配置和使用
- double java 坑,Java中四则运算的那些坑
- APP测试入门之性能测试
- golang 结构体struct 标签tag 标记 `` 简介
- FMS4.5( Adobe Flash Media Server4.5)流媒体服务器搭建
- cocos2d 解密ccbi_cocos2d-x高级学习
- leetcode 两个数组的交集 II
- 阿里涉足零售IoT的猜想
- 2014 Super Training #2 F The Bridges of Kolsberg --DP
- 【Spring 5】响应式Web框架实战(上) 1
- 【BZOJ4557】[JLoi2016]侦察守卫 树形DP
- Go语言编程快速入门
- 音视频即时通讯 功能需求汇总
- 串口转WIFI的工作方式理解
- 60秒倒计时钟单片机实物程序
- 从根上理解高性能、高并发(七):深入操作系统,一文读懂进程、线程、协程
- 【MQTT】MQTT协议学习
- 视频监控安防平台-国标28181平台(支持国标28181转RTSP/RTMP/HLS/WEBRTC直播)
- 启用群晖 Drive 的团队文件夹